The Fox River Open was held on Monday, June 11, at The MAX in McCook. Nearly 50 prospects from all high school classes participated in a pro-style workout in front of the Illinois scouting staff. We began the rollout of the event with a look at the catchers in attendance followed by infielders, outfielders and pitchers. 

Today we conclude the analysis of the event with a look at the top five prospects in attendance.

TOP OVERALL PROSPECTS

1. Brandon Micetich, INF, Plainfield Central, 2020
6-foot, 168-pound, athletic build, projectable framed, left handed hitting infielder. Offensively, balanced set up, natural smooth load, high leg kick, short stride, good lower half balance. Fast bat speed, level bat path, lets ball get deep, extension through baseball, gap-gap approach, fluid rhythm throughout, uphill finish, 82 exit velocity off tee. Defensively, long arm action, high ¾ release, throws 73-mph across infield. Ran 6.98 in the 60, laser-timed.
